Netanyahu publicly supports Trump’s Nobel Peace Prize bid after a U.S.-brokered ceasefire ends two years of conflict in Gaza, with over 67,000 Palestinians killed, officials said.
- Georgia GOP Representative Buddy Carter announced proposed legislation to nominate President Donald Trump for the Nobel Peace Prize due to his diplomatic efforts, which include a new agreement between Israel and Hamas for a ceasefire.
- Jubilant crowds in Gaza and Israel celebrated the ceasefire, chanting Trump's name and calling for him to receive the Nobel Peace Prize.
- Trump's nomination has received support from world leaders like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u and the government of Pakistan, citing his global peace efforts.
- Despite the recent peace deal, Trump was not awarded the 2025 Nobel Peace Prize, which went to María Corina Machado, as the committee's decision was made prior to the announcement of the agreement.

Netanyahu praises Trump over hostage release and ceasefire plan
Benjamin Netanyahu praised Donald Trump and the Israeli military after Israel’s cabinet met on Thursday (9 October) and confirmed it had approved a hostage release plan around 23:30pm BST. A ceasefire was supposed to start immediately, giving the military 24 hours to complete its withdrawal. Exchange of the Day
Nobel Committee chair Jørgen Watne Frydnes spoke to reporters: REPORTER: Why didn’t Trump win the Nobel Peace Prize? FRYDNES: This committee sits in a room filled with the portraits of all laureates. That room is filled with both courage and integrity. We only base our decision on the work and the will of Alfred Nobel.
